Uniting Collier County And Its Art Community

United Arts Collier (UAC) is the heart of the arts in Collier County—where creativity catalyzes community.

As the county’s official Local Arts Agency, UAC serves as Collier’s arts umbrella and a unifying cultural force. We are in service to all of Collier through all the arts, harnessing their transformative power to cultivate meaningful partnerships among individuals, organizations, businesses, and civic entities—positively impacting lives across the county and beyond.

As a uniting thread through the full spectrum of the arts, UAC enriches the lives of residents and visitors alike through robust arts education programs, exhibitions, performances, outreach initiatives, special events, art therapy, and more.

As a 501(c)(3) nonprofit charity, UAC depends on the generosity of corporate sponsors, grantmakers, and individual donors to fulfill our mission of enriching lives through the power of the arts.

What We Mean by “All the Arts for All of Collier”

  • “All the arts” includes—though is not limited to—visual arts, performing arts, literary arts, and culinary arts.
  • “All of Collier” refers to both the geographic and demographic reach of our work, spanning all ages, abilities, cultures, and communities throughout the county.
  • The word “for” emphasizes not only advocacy for the arts themselves, but the profound impact the arts have on the well-being, identity, and vitality of our entire community.

Key Art Programs And Initiatives

  • Arts Education: Delivering programs to at-risk students and expanding access for those who might otherwise miss out.
  • Community Events: Hosting fundraisers like the Seaside Soirée at Seagate Beach Club, featuring live music, art-making, culinary delights, and sunset views over the Gulf. We have hosted events such as those honoring journalist Harriet Heithaus for her contributions to local arts coverage.
  • Artist Support: Showcasing emerging and established talents through exhibitions, like the “Sense of Home” artist showcase at Naples Airport, and calls for submissions (e.g., NIFF poster designs themed around film as multidisciplinary art).
  • Collier Arts Archive: Preserving the county’s cultural history.
  • Membership and Fundraising: Annual memberships start with benefits like event invites and recognition, fueling programs through campaigns like “$25k for the Arts.”

What is United Arts Collier?

United Arts Collier (UAC) is the official heart of creativity for every person who lives, works, or visits Collier County.

Our History and Role

Furthermore, we are the State of Florida’s designated Local Arts Agency for Collier County.

In addition, we function as the central arts umbrella — much like a chamber of commerce for the arts — connecting visual, performing, literary, culinary, and all other creative disciplines with the communities that need them most.

For example, since our founding in 1980 and official recognition as the Local Arts Agency in 1984, we have grown into a trusted 501(c)(3) nonprofit.

Consequently, under CEO Elysia Dawn — a Naples native with international arts leadership experience — we refreshed our identity with the powerful promise: All the Arts for All of Collier.

The Programs That Touch Every Life

Moreover, our reach extends across every age, ability, and background.

Through these efforts, we provide free arts education to approximately 2,500 at-risk youth each year.

In turn, we also deliver free classes and art therapy for seniors living with Alzheimer’s or dementia, veterans, and anyone who might otherwise miss these opportunities.

Additionally, we preserve our county’s cultural heritage through the Collier Arts Archives project with Florida Humanities and produce vibrant public events such as the Seaside Soirée and the inaugural Naples International Dance Festival on May 11, 2026.

The Real Impact on Collier County

For instance, arts experiences in our region generate real economic power.

As a result, attendees spend an average of $31 to $48 per person beyond ticket costs on dining, lodging, and parking — turning every exhibition or performance into a boost for local businesses.

Therefore, our weekly Best Bets newsletter now reaches more than 5,000 subscribers, while our county-wide arts calendar helps thousands discover events in real time.

Ultimately, we also advocate for stronger arts funding, more public art, and greater arts education in schools because creativity improves health, education, safety, and quality of life across the entire community.
